What is Email Marketing?

Email marketing is a form of digital marketing that involves sending promotional messages or updates via email to customers or subscribers. It’s a popular and effective way for businesses to reach and engage with their audience, and can help build brand awareness, increase customer loyalty, and drive sales.

Email marketing can be defined in multiple types depending upon the perspective of the business.

A general division of Email marketing is as shown below:

  • Welcome mails
  • Newsletters
  • Promotional emails
  • Survey mails
  • Invitation emails, etc.

To begin an email marketing campaign, businesses must first build an email list of subscribers who have opted in to receive their emails. This can be done through various channels, such as website sign-ups, social media, or in-store sign-ups. It’s important to ensure that subscribers understand what they are signing up for and that they can easily opt-out at any time.

Once a business has a list of subscribers, they can begin to send targeted email messages with promotions, updates, or other offers. Email marketing can be especially effective for personalized messages, such as abandoned cart reminders or birthday promotions.

When creating email messages, it’s important to ensure that the messages are well-crafted, visually appealing, and targeted to the specific audience. This can help improve open rates, click-through rates, and ultimately drive sales.

Additionally, businesses can use email marketing to gather feedback or conduct surveys to learn more about their customers and improve their offerings. This can be a valuable way to get insights from customers and make data-driven decisions.

When using email marketing, it’s important to ensure that the messages comply with relevant regulations and guidelines, such as CAN-SPAM laws. This can help ensure that messages are delivered to subscribers’ inboxes and that businesses maintain a positive reputation.
